Emerging Trends and Innovations

Biotechnological Advances

Research into enzymatic customization of dextrin APIs allows for tailored molecular weight distributions, enhancing functionality for specific pharmaceutical applications such as ICODEXTRIN.

Sustainability and Responsible Sourcing

Manufacturers are increasingly focusing on sustainable sourcing of raw materials like corn or tapioca, aligning with global environmental standards and increasing consumer trust.

Regulatory Developments

Global harmonization efforts, such as ICH guidelines and FDA regulations, necessitate that API suppliers maintain rigorous compliance, emphasizing documentation, traceability, and quality management systems.


Challenges in API Sourcing

  • Regulatory Variability: Differing standards across jurisdictions complicate supplier qualification.
  • Quality Assurance: Ensuring API purity, absence of contaminants, and consistent physicochemical properties require thorough assessment.
  • Cost Constraints: Balancing quality with pricing remains a persistent challenge, particularly when sourcing from low-cost regions.
